Inspection Solutions. A Legacy Forged in Flux The MFE story is not just a catalog of equipment; it
is a legacy of preventing disaster. It began in 1994 when Bill Duke and Dave
Amos founded MFE Enterprises. They hit the heavy industrial ground running,
pioneering advanced Magnetic Flux Leakage (MFL) technology specifically
engineered to interrogate the structural health of massive storage tanks and
pipelines. By developing rugged, high-speed tools like the 65-pound Mark IV
Tank Floor Scanner and the highly maneuverable MFE Edge, they fundamentally changed
how the industry detects fatal flaws, making extreme-duty inspections faster,
more accurate, and highly cost-effective. The Arsenal of Advanced Diagnostics Today, MFE operates as a unified engineering force

operational safety standards. A Unified Global Force Refusing to remain a localized operation, MFE
Inspection Solutions aggressively expanded its footprint in 2009, scaling
rapidly from a modest Texas office into a global diagnostic powerhouse
operating out of 13 strategic locations across four countries. To ensure their highly sensitive equipment never
loses its absolute, pinpoint precision in the field, MFE strategically
acquired NDT Electronics in 2016. Originally founded in 1981 by William
Ganch, Jr., this addition brought decades of elite calibration and repair
expertise under the MFE umbrella, dramatically broadening their ability to
service, supply, and maintain the industry's most critical testing equipment. By seamlessly combining decades of frontline
